Transaction 1978b4ee13351c166472f1cbe81e25a23f4b68372a150bee8ece8822da0acc3f

2 Input
2 Outputs
  • 1978b4ee13351c166472f1cbe81e25a23f4b68372a150bee8ece8822da0acc3f:0
  • value  997341
    address  3DuSLR9Pt4kSbjuiKKFiKXrGTqPAoJBdae
  • 1978b4ee13351c166472f1cbe81e25a23f4b68372a150bee8ece8822da0acc3f:1
  • value  1500000
    address  3JF8W2fGBZG4y4xtcxdSux2dW8HzJoK2o9